WKC vs. CRDO
WKC (World Kinect Corporation) and CRDO (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d) are both stocks. WKC operates in Oil & Gas Refining & Marketing (Energy), while CRDO operates in Semiconductors (Technology). Over the past 3 years, WKC returned 24.13%/yr vs 130.87%/yr for CRDO. Their 0.13 correlation means their historical movements had little consistent relationship.

WKC vs. CRDO - Profitability Comparison
WKC -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Aug 2026, World Kinect Corporation reported a gross profit of 365.10M and revenue of 13.67B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 2.7%.
CRDO -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Aug 2026,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d reported a gross profit of 298.07M and revenue of 437.00M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 68.2%.
WKC -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Aug 2026, World Kinect Corporation reported an operating income of 132.50M and revenue of 13.67B, resulting in an operating margin of 1.0%.
CRDO -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Aug 2026,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d reported an operating income of 155.85M and revenue of 437.00M, resulting in an operating margin of 35.7%.
WKC -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Aug 2026, World Kinect Corporation reported a net income of 49.00M and revenue of 13.67B, resulting in a net margin of 0.4%.
CRDO -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Aug 2026,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d reported a net income of 169.10M and revenue of 437.00M, resulting in a net margin of 38.7%.
